Overdose Deaths in Oklahoma

The state of Oklahoma has been significantly impacted by the opioid crisis. In 2020 alone, there were over 500 overdose deaths related to prescription drugs in the state, highlighting the severity of the issue. Oklahoma City, in particular, has one of the highest rates of prescription drug abuse in the United States [2]. The effects of the global pandemic have likely contributed to the rise in prescription opioid abuse, with a spike of 13.5% in overdose-related deaths reported in March 2020 compared to 2018.

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T)

For individuals seeking recovery from prescription drug addiction, medication-assisted treatment (MAT) can be a valuable approach. MAT is an evidence-based strategy that combines medication with counseling and behavioral therapies to treat substance use disorders [4]. This comprehensive approach addresses both the physical and psychological aspects of addiction, providing individuals with the necessary support to achieve and maintain long-term recovery.

Supporting Long-Term Recovery

MAT can play a crucial role in supporting long-term recovery from prescription drug dependency [1]. By utilizing medications such as buprenorphine, methadone, or naltrexone, MAT helps reduce cravings, prevent withdrawal symptoms, and normalize brain function. This can significantly increase the chances of successful recovery by minimizing the intense physical and psychological challenges often associated with prescription drug addiction.

One of the notable advantages of MAT is its ability to stabilize individuals' lives, allowing them to focus on their recovery journey. By managing cravings and withdrawal symptoms, MAT helps individuals regain control over their lives and reduces the risk of relapse. It provides a foundation for individuals to actively engage in therapy and counseling, addressing the underlying issues and developing coping mechanisms for lasting change.

Effectiveness in Recovery

Research has shown that MAT can have significant positive outcomes for individuals with prescription drug addiction. It improves treatment retention, reduces illicit drug use, decreases overdose deaths, and improves overall health outcomes. By combining medication with counseling and behavioral therapies, MAT offers a comprehensive approach that addresses the multifaceted nature of addiction.

Medical Detoxification

Medical detoxification, as explained by Legends Recovery, involves a supervised withdrawal process from addictive substances under medical supervision. This treatment option is essential for individuals who require medical support to manage withdrawal symptoms safely. Medical detoxification ensures that individuals have access to medical professionals who can monitor their progress and provide appropriate care during the detoxification process.

During medical detoxification, individuals receive personalized treatment plans tailored to their specific needs. The goal is to help individuals rid their bodies of the substances while managing withdrawal symptoms and addressing any potential complications that may arise.

Inpatient vs. Outpatient Programs

Inpatient and outpatient programs, as mentioned by New Horizons Center, are two primary treatment options for individuals recovering from prescription drug dependency. Each option offers unique benefits and is suited to different individuals based on their specific circumstances.

Inpatient rehabilitation programs, also known as residential programs, provide a structured and immersive environment for individuals seeking recovery from prescription drug addiction. These programs require individuals to live within the treatment facility for a designated period. The structured environment allows individuals to focus solely on their recovery without the distractions and temptations of the outside world. Inpatient programs often include a combination of individual therapy, group therapy, support groups, and other therapeutic activities to address the physical, emotional, and psychological aspects of addiction.

On the other hand, outpatient programs offer flexibility for individuals who may have responsibilities or obligations that prevent them from committing to a residential program. Outpatient programs allow individuals to receive treatment while still residing at home. This option is suitable for individuals with a strong support system and a stable living environment. Outpatient programs typically involve regular therapy sessions, counseling, group therapy, and educational programs to support individuals in their recovery journey.
